Complete set · 11capabilities

The complete Factor (Cofactr) capability set.

These are the exact actions your AI can choose when you ask it to work with Factor (Cofactr).

Capability set01 / 03

01—04

4 capabilities in this set.

Part of 11 available through Factor (Cofactr).

  1. 01 Capability

    Get purchase order

    Pull the details for a specific purchase order. You can use this to check shipping dates or current status.

  2. 02 Capability

    Get rfq

    View the details of a specific request for quote. It helps you see which suppliers have responded to your sourcing needs.

  3. 03 Capability

    Get supplier

    Get specific details for a single supplier in your network. This helps you quickly find contact info or vetting status.

  4. 04 Capability

    List inventory

    See current stock levels across all your warehouses. Use this to get a bird's eye view of your available components.

  1. Step 01

    Open Connectors

    In Claude Web or Claude Desktop, open Settings and choose Connectors.

  2. Step 02

    Add the URL

    Choose Add custom connector, name it Factor (Cofactr), and paste the URL above.

  3. Step 03

    Turn it on in chat

    Select +, open Connectors, and enable Factor (Cofactr) for the conversation.

How do I obtain my Factor/Cofactr API Key?

API access is available to Cofactr enterprise customers. Reach out to your account manager or point of contact at Cofactr to request a Platform API key.

What systems does Factor integrate with?

Factor (Cofactr) is designed to sync with major ERP systems like NetSuite, Oracle, and SAP, as well as PLM capabilities like Arena and Altium.
